Henry VIII's Machiavellian Dissolution

The chapter explores Henry VIII's intricate motivations for the dissolution of the monasteries, emphasizing his desire to break with Rome, marry Anne Boleyn, and assert his political authority. It delves into the complex relationship between Henry and Cromwell, shedding light on the propaganda, conflicting agendas, and challenges surrounding the evaluation of monastic wealth. The narrative highlights the brutal consequences faced by rebels and the societal disbelief akin to the Holocaust in response to the widespread dissolution.
